(A note for our friends who are not LDS: Lehi, who is mentioned in this video clip, was the Book of Mormon prophet who was commanded to take his family into the wilderness to escape the destruction that would be coming upon because the people would not repent. In his vision of the Tree of Life he saw many people pressing forward to the tree which represented the love of God to partake of its delicious fruit. Only those who held fast to the iron rod were able to make it safely through the dark mists of temptation to the tree. Because of the mocking of those in the high and spacious building, a building which represented the pride of the world and had no foundation, many were ashamed and let go of the rod.
